Selecting the Right Black Island Cooker Hood
When picking the appropriate black island cooker hood, a number of considerations come into play:
1. Size and Compatibility
Picking the ideal size is vital for optimum efficiency. The hood should be at least as broad as the cooktop and ideally extend a couple of inches beyond the edges. House owners ought to measure their cooking area to choose a compatible design.
2. Ventilation TypeDucted: Vents air outside, providing much better smell and smoke removal.Ductless: Uses filters to clean up the air and recirculates it inside your home, suitable for homes without external ventilation choices.3. Power and Efficiency
Look for hoods with an appropriate CFM (Cubic Feet per Minute) rating. A greater CFM rating suggests more air movement, which is beneficial for intense cooking. The energy effectiveness score is also essential for long-term cost savings and sustainability.
4. Noise Level
Various models run at various noise levels, typically measured in sones. Homeowners should think about how much noise they can tolerate, specifically if the kitchen frequently ends up being a social area.
5. Maintenance and Cleaning
Reduce of maintenance is another element to consider. Models with removable filters that can be cleaned quickly will conserve time and effort in upkeep.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)What is the ideal height for setting up a black island cooker hood?
The suggested height for installing an island cooker hood is generally between 28 to 36 inches above the cooktop. This height can differ based on the design of the hood and the types of cooking being performed.
How frequently should the filters in a ductless hood be changed?
It is recommended to change the charcoal filters in a ductless hood every 6 to 12 months, depending on use frequency. Regular maintenance ensures that the hood operates successfully.
Can I set up an island cooker hood myself?
While some house owners might have the abilities to set up a cooker hood themselves, it is normally recommended to employ an expert, particularly for ducted models that need complex installation.
Are black island cooker hoods loud?
Noise levels vary by design, however many black island cooker hoods are designed to run silently. Homeowners should examine the specs for the sones level when comparing choices.
